What are the evidences of being chosen by God?

Answered in 1 source

Evidences of being chosen include faith in Christ, a love for others, and perseverance in trials.

In 1 Thessalonians 1, the Apostle Paul provides evidences of divine election, which include believing the Gospel, receiving it not merely as human words but as the powerful Word of God. The transformation in the believer's life is also marked by a love for others and the ability to endure trials with joy. A genuine believer will show these characteristics as they are engendered by the Holy Spirit working within them. This aligns with the teachings found in Galatians 5, where the fruits of the Spirit reflect God's work in the believer’s life and thus serve as evidence of one's election.
Scripture References: 1 Thessalonians 1, Galatians 5
